The Rise of Smart Security Systems
Smart security systems are becoming increasingly popular. These systems integrate advanced technology to provide better monitoring and control.
IoT Integration: The Internet of Things (IoT) is playing a significant role in physical security. Devices like smart cameras and sensors can communicate with each other, providing real-time data. This connectivity allows for quicker responses to potential threats.
Remote Monitoring: With smart security systems, you can monitor your property from anywhere. Mobile apps allow you to view live feeds, receive alerts, and even control security features remotely. This flexibility is crucial for businesses with multiple locations.
Enhanced Access Control Solutions
Access control is a critical aspect of physical security. In 2024, we will see more advanced solutions that improve safety and convenience.
Biometric Authentication: Fingerprint and facial recognition technologies are becoming standard. These methods are more secure than traditional keycards or PIN codes. They reduce the risk of unauthorized access.
Mobile Credentials: Many organizations are shifting to mobile credentials. Employees can use their smartphones to gain access to secure areas. This method is not only convenient but also reduces the need for physical keycards.
Increased Focus on Cyber-Physical Security
As technology advances, the line between physical and cyber security is blurring. In 2024, businesses will need to address both aspects.
Integrated Security Systems: Companies are investing in integrated systems that combine physical and cyber security measures. This approach ensures that both areas are protected and monitored effectively.
Training and Awareness: Employees must be trained to recognize potential threats in both physical and digital environments. Regular training sessions can help create a culture of security awareness.
The Importance of Data Analytics
Data analytics is transforming how security is managed. In 2024, organizations will leverage data to enhance their security strategies.
Predictive Analytics: By analyzing historical data, businesses can identify patterns and predict potential security threats. This proactive approach allows for better preparedness.
Real-Time Monitoring: Data analytics tools can provide real-time insights into security events. This information helps security teams respond quickly to incidents.
Sustainability in Security Solutions
Sustainability is becoming a priority in many industries, including security. In 2024, expect to see more eco-friendly security solutions.
Energy-Efficient Systems: Many security devices are now designed to consume less energy. This not only reduces costs but also minimizes the environmental impact.
Sustainable Materials: Companies are opting for security products made from sustainable materials. This trend reflects a growing commitment to environmental responsibility.
The Role of Artificial Intelligence
Artificial intelligence (AI) is revolutionizing physical security. In 2024, AI will play a more significant role in various security applications.
Smart Surveillance: AI-powered cameras can analyze video feeds in real-time. They can detect unusual behavior and alert security personnel immediately.
Automated Responses: AI can help automate responses to security incidents. For example, if a camera detects a breach, it can trigger alarms and notify authorities without human intervention.
